The renewal of our three-year agreement with Torvane Materials has been assessed in detail. Proposed terms include a 4.2% unit-price increase, partially offset by improved volume rebates and extended payment terms of sixty days. Sensitivity analysis indicates a net annual cost impact of under 1% on the Meridia product line, assuming stable demand. Legal has flagged no material changes to liability clauses. We recommend approval, subject to the conditions outlined in the confidential note below.

confidential, yawip-bahif: Zorokox Partners plans to lower the Casax list price by 28.0 percent in April. The board signed off on a budget of $271.0 million for Project Juldor. The renewal with Pelokox Partners closes at $410.1 million a year, 3.4 percent below the last contract. Project Pelok slips by a full year because of the audit delay.

Q: How does the Gleanport retention sweeper decide what to purge?
A: Nightly job. Reads policy tags, deletes records past TTL, writes an audit manifest to cold storage. Dry-run mode is default in staging. Manual overrides require two approvals. If the sweeper's signing vault is sealed after a restart, recovery is manual. The passphrase needed to unseal it is below.

recovery phrase for fajep-yaweg: gilath-sorox-wenius-rusdor-keliel-zorius

**Vendor note: Inkmill markdown pipeline**

Rendering for Parchway docs is outsourced to Inkmill under an annual contract, renewing each March. They handle sanitization and PDF export; we own the upload queue. SLA: 4-hour response on rendering failures. Escalate only after two failed retries. Their support desk is reachable at the address below.

billing contact of hahaf-baguf = zorael.tammir.jorius@sivrelhq.internal

Hey — handing over webhook delivery in Corvid Relay before I rotate off. Quick summary for plugin authors: we retry failed deliveries five times with exponential backoff, capped at six hours, and a 2xx within ten seconds counts as success. Anything else gets retried, so make your handlers idempotent — duplicate deliveries are expected, not a bug. Dead-lettered events stick around for a week. The full retry schedule and signature verification details are written up on the internal page.

runbook for tafof-yawif: https://confluence.tolvaqsys.internal/display/display/browse/pages/7be3